摘要
Isolated ultrafine palladium particles prepared by a gas-evaporation method have been chemically supported on a flat glassy carbon substrate using a silane coupling agent. The modification of the ultrafine palladium particles with the silane coupling agent was confirmed by FT-IR spectroscopy and transmission electron microscopy (TEM). The supported palladium particles did electrochemical sorption-desorption of hydrogen in an acidic solution.
